The mission of Carondelet Foundation is to build supportive relationships through philanthropy, stewardship and education, which sustain and enhance the community's trust in Carondelet Health Network.

 

PURPOSE STATEMENT
The purpose of Carondelet Foundation is to solicit, receive, maintain and manage gifts, money and property, and to distribute them to Carondelet Health Network and its communities to support the charitable activities related to Carondelet Health Network and the health care mission of the Sisters of St. Joseph of Carondelet.

OVERVIEW
Carondelet Foundation was established in May 1993 by combining three separate foundations for St. Mary’s, St. Joseph’s and Holy Cross Hospitals to solicit, accept, manage and invest donations for the exclusive benefit of Carondelet Health Network and it’s programs and services. Carondelet Foundation is incorporated under Carondelet Health Network with a listing in the Catholic Directory and is thereby recognized as a tax-exempt organization as described in Subsections 501(c)(3) and 509(a) of the Internal Revenue Code. Therefore, all donations made to Carondelet Foundation are tax deductible to the extent allowed by law.

A Board of Trustees comprised of 25 community representatives governs Carondelet Foundation. The Foundation's efforts are augmented by more than 600 auxiliary members and hospital volunteers as well as a community fund-raising group, The Centurions.

Carondelet Foundation advances the mission of Carondelet Health Network through fund-raising programs including an annual community campaign, direct mail appeals, special events, grants development, and planned giving. The Foundation serves its three non-profit hospitals.

These four hospitals locally comprise Carondelet Health Network which joined forces with Ascension Health System in 2002. Ascension Health is the largest private non-profit Catholic hospital system in the United States and has over 60 hospitals in more than 20 states and is sponsored by four provinces of the Daughters of Charity, the Sisters of St. Joseph of Nazareth and the Sisters of St. Joseph of Carondelet.

The Foundation adheres to the highest ethical standards with regard to fundraising and fund management. The Foundation’s financial records are audited annually by an accounting firm selected by Carondelet Health Network.
